Welcome, future maintainer. Pickpath is the optimizer that turns raw warehouse orders into sane walking routes for the Binhollow fulfillment floor. Most tuning lives in `.env`: `PP_ZONE_MAP` points at the floor layout file, `PP_BATCH_SIZE` caps orders per route, and `PP_SOLVER_TIMEOUT_MS` keeps the solver from wandering off. You can leave the rest alone unless the floor layout changes. One thing you can't skip: the optimizer authenticates to the Binhollow orders API with a service credential, set on this line:

vault entry, kagep-yajeg: COURIER_KEY5=da097

**Vendor note: Inkmill markdown pipeline**

Rendering for Parchway docs is outsourced to Inkmill under an annual contract, renewing each March. They handle sanitization and PDF export; we own the upload queue. SLA: 4-hour response on rendering failures. Escalate only after two failed retries. Their support desk is reachable at the address below.

billing contact of hahaf-baguf = zorael.tammir.jorius@sivrelhq.internal

Handover: ScanBridge barcode integration. Dex — queue is stable, but the Varrick warehouse scanners drop offline nightly around 02:00; watch the reconnect job. Parser fixes merged, not yet deployed. Creds for the device-registry vault rotate Monday. If the vault seals before then, unseal manually. The recovery passphrase for that is below.

vault phrase of bagaf-kajeg = jorath-feniel-briir-siliel-ralix

Ticket #4482 — Vault locked, report export timezones. Welcome aboard! The Quillhaven export vault auto-locked after three failed attempts while we were fixing UTC offsets in the nightly report job. Exports currently render in server-local time instead of the customer's zone. To unlock the vault and resume testing, use the recovery passphrase below.

recovery phrase for fajep-yaweg: gilath-sorox-wenius-rusdor-keliel-zorius